Do braces hurt / does teeth braces hurt

Braces commonly cause pressure and tenderness after placement or adjustment, but sharp wire irritation and severe pain need attention.

The short answer

Brackets, archwires, and elastics apply controlled force through the periodontal ligament around each tooth. This can make chewing tender, while a protruding wire can rub the cheek.

Choose soft foods while teeth feel tender, brush around brackets, and use orthodontic wax over rubbing hardware. Do not bend an appliance without instructions.

Contact the orthodontic team for severe pain, a loose bracket, embedded wire, facial swelling, or inability to eat normally.
